Adams v. State

519 So. 2d 752, 1988 Fla. App. LEXIS 506, 1988 WL 8090
District Court of Appeal of Florida·Decided February 10, 1988·No. No. 87-1780·Published·Cited by 1 cases

Opinion

PER CURIAM.

We affirm, without prejudice to appellant to file within thirty days a proper motion pursuant to Florida Rule of Criminal Procedure 3.850. See Daniels v. State, 450 So. 2d 601 (Fla. 4th DCA 1984).

LETTS, GLICKSTEIN and STONE, JJ., concur.
